With 579 people, ZIP 16114 is a ZIP code in Mercer County. At a median age of 52.3, this is an older place than the country as a whole. Owners hold 89% of the housing stock. 19% of adults hold a bachelor's degree, below the 36% national rate. 0% of people in this ZIP code were born outside the United States. Renters pay $482 a month at the median. Among the 20 ZIP codes in Mercer County, 16114 ranks 8th by median household income.
How many people live in ZIP code 16114?
ZIP code 16114 has about 579 residents according to the 2024 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in ZIP code 16114?
The typical household in ZIP code 16114 earns about $69,500 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is ZIP code 16114 expensive?
In ZIP code 16114, the median home is worth about $200,000, and the typical rent is about $482 a month.
How educated are people in ZIP code 16114?
About 19.0% of adults age 25 and over in ZIP code 16114 h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in ZIP code 16114?
About 12.3% of people in ZIP code 16114 live below the federal poverty line.
